ASTM Revises PVC Standards for Doors and Windows

Sep 27th, 2013

ASTM International has published a revision to its BSR/ASTM D4726-201x, Specification for Rigid Poly Vinyl Chloride (PVC). The standard relates to exterior-profile extrusions used for assembled windows and doors. This is a revision of ANSI/ASTM D4726-2009. Kenneth F. Yarosh Named 2012 ASTM International Chairman of the Board

Jan 23rd, 2012

Kenneth F. Yarosh, global service line manager for the specialty chemicals business of Dow Corning Corp., in Midland, Mich., is the 2012 chairman of the board of directors of ASTM International.
